What is a Whole-House Air Filtration System?

Unlike portable air purifiers that only clean the air in a single room, a whole-house air filtration system works seamlessly with your existing heating and air conditioning (HVAC) system to purify the air throughout your entire home. Installed directly within your home's ductwork, this system captures airborne contaminants before they can circulate into your living areas. As your HVAC system draws air through the return ducts, it passes through the specialized whole-house filter, which traps particles. The newly cleaned air is then distributed through your supply vents to every room, providing consistent, comprehensive air purification for your entire household.

Types of Whole-House Air Filtration Systems We Install

Goode Air Conditioning & Heating offers a range of whole-house air filtration solutions, each designed to meet different needs and budgets. Our experts can help you determine the ideal system for your Crosby home.

  • MERV-Rated Media Filters: These are highly efficient pleated filters designed to capture a wide range of airborne particles, from common dust and pollen to mold spores and pet dander. MERV (Minimum Efficiency Reporting Value) ratings indicate a filter's effectiveness, with higher MERV ratings (e.g., MERV 11-16) offering superior filtration capabilities. These filters provide excellent air cleaning for most homes and are a significant upgrade over standard furnace filters. They are cost-effective and relatively easy to maintain.
  • HEPA Filters: HEPA (High-Efficiency Particulate Air) filters are the gold standard for air purification, capable of trapping 99.97% of particles as small as 0.3 microns. This includes dust, pollen, mold, bacteria, and even some viruses. Due to their dense construction, HEPA filters are typically installed in a bypass system or require a specialized HVAC unit to ensure proper airflow. They are ideal for households with severe allergies, asthma, or compromised immune systems, offering the highest level of filtration.
  • Electronic Air Cleaners (Electrostatic Precipitators): These systems use an electrostatic charge to attract and capture airborne particles. As air passes through, particles are ionized and then collected on charged plates within the unit. Electronic air cleaners are highly effective at removing very fine particles, including smoke and odors, and their collector plates are often washable, reducing the need for frequent filter replacements.
  • UV Germicidal Lights: While not a filtration system in the traditional sense, UV lights are often integrated into whole-house air quality solutions. Installed within the HVAC system's ductwork or near the evaporator coil, UV-C light targets and neutralizes airborne biological contaminants like mold, bacteria, and viruses as they pass through. This effectively inhibits their growth and reproduction, providing an additional layer of defense against pathogens.

Maintaining Your Whole-House Air Filtration System

To ensure your whole-house air filtration system continues to operate at peak efficiency and provide optimal air quality, regular maintenance is essential. Depending on the type of system installed, this typically involves periodic filter replacement or cleaning. MERV-rated and HEPA filters require replacement, usually every 6-12 months, though this can vary based on factors like pet ownership, household activity, and local air quality. Electronic air cleaner plates should be cleaned regularly, often every 1-3 months. How is a whole-house filter different from a standard furnace filter?

Standard furnace filters are primarily designed to protect your HVAC equipment from large particles, preventing them from damaging the system. Whole-house air filtration systems, on the other hand, are specifically designed for advanced air purification. They use higher-grade media or technology to capture significantly smaller particles and a wider range of contaminants, providing superior air quality for your living spaces in addition to protecting your equipment.

How often do I need to change filters in a whole-house system?

The frequency of filter replacement depends on the specific type of whole-house filtration system you have, as well as factors like household size, presence of pets, and local air quality. Generally, high-MERV media filters may need to be replaced every 6 to 12 months, while HEPA filters can last longer. Electronic air cleaner plates are typically cleaned rather than replaced, with cleaning recommended every 1 to 3 months.
